Asia Pacific Automated Test Equipment (ATE) Market Overview
The Asia Pacific Automated Test Equipment (ATE) market is valued at USD 2,986 billion, based on a five-year historical analysis. This valuation is driven by the escalating demand for consumer electronics, advancements in semiconductor technologies, and the proliferation of connected devices. The region's robust manufacturing sector and the integration of ATE in automotive and telecommunications industries further bolster market growth.
China and Taiwan are the dominant players in the Asia Pacific ATE market. China's dominance stems from its expansive electronics manufacturing base and substantial investments in semiconductor fabrication. Taiwan's leadership is attributed to its advanced semiconductor industry and the presence of major foundries and testing facilities. Both countries benefit from strong government support and a skilled workforce, reinforcing their positions in the market.

Asia Pacific Automated Test Equipment (ATE) Market Segmentation
By Product Type: The market is segmented by product type into Non- Memory ATE, Memory ATE, and Discrete ATE. Non- Memory ATE holds a dominant market share due to its critical role in testing complex integrated circuits and logic devices. The increasing complexity of semiconductor devices necessitates sophisticated testing solutions, thereby driving the demand for Non- Memory ATE.
By End- User Industry: The market is further segmented by end-user industry into Consumer Electronics, Automotive, Telecommunications, and Industrial Manufacturing. The Consumer Electronics segment dominates the market, driven by the continuous innovation and high production volumes of devices such as smartphones, tablets, and wearable technology. The rapid product cycles and the need for high-quality assurance in consumer electronics amplify the reliance on ATE systems.

Asia Pacific Automated Test Equipment (ATE) Industry Analysis
Growth Drivers
Demand for High- Speed Semiconductor Devices: As global digital transformation continues, the demand for high-speed semiconductor devices has surged. In 2023, global data consumption reached 73.5 zettabytes, driven by the proliferation of high-definition video streaming and increased data-intensive applications. This demand is expected to be propelled further by enhanced 5G adoption and expansion in machine learning applications, both requiring faster and more reliable semiconductors.
Expansion of Consumer Electronics and IoT Market: Consumer electronics and IoT are growing rapidly, with the global shipment of IoT devices surpassing 14.7 billion units in 2023, according to International Energy Agency (IEA). Devices like smart home products, wearable electronics, and healthcare monitoring systems contribute heavily to this expansion. Data from the IMF shows a rise in consumer spending, with global household expenditure increasing by $4 trillion from 2022, which supports increased adoption of consumer electronics globally, particularly in Asia- Pacific and North America.
Increasing Complexity in Automotive Electronics: The automotive industry is witnessing increased demand for complex electronics due to the push for electric vehicles (EVs) and autonomous driving technology. In 2023, the global automotive industry registered over 11 million EVs, marking a substantial rise from previous years, as reported by the IEA. The complexity of automotive electronics has led to demand for advanced testing equipment to ensure component reliability and performance.
Market Challenges
High Initial Setup and R&D Costs: Setting up facilities for semiconductor manufacturing and testing requires significant capital investment. For instance, it costs approximately $10-20 billion to establish a cutting-edge semiconductor fabrication plant, according to the U.S. Department of Commerce. Further, the R&D costs associated with developing advanced testing equipment are substantial due to rapid technological changes and high regulatory standards in the industry. High setup and R&D costs remain a critical challenge, especially for smaller players in the market.
Rapid Changes in Semiconductor Technologies: The semiconductor industry experiences rapid technological advancements, which pose challenges in maintaining up-to-date testing equipment and standards. The ITU reported that the lifecycle of semiconductor technology has shortened significantly, with new generations emerging every 2-3 years. This quick progression demands continuous investment in testing equipment upgrades to remain compatible with emerging technologies, creating a constant operational strain for companies in this market.

Market Opportunities
Expansion in Emerging Economies: Emerging economies are seeing substantial investments in semiconductor manufacturing, with India and Vietnam emerging as notable markets. In 2023, the Indian government allocated over $2 billion in incentives to attract semiconductor manufacturers, as noted by the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ology, India. Similarly, Vietnam is attracting significant foreign investments, with an increase in FDI in technology manufacturing, totaling $12.5 billion in 2023. This expansion represents an opportunity for growth in the semiconductor testing equipment market within these regions.
Development of AI-Integrated Testing Solutions: AI integration in semiconductor testing solutions is gaining traction, especially with the advancement of predictive maintenance and defect detection.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, the integration of AI can reduce test cycle times by up to 40%, streamlining the overall manufacturing process. As of 2023, AI-enhanced testing is becoming common in North America and Europe, with further potential in emerging regions, making it a promising growth avenue for the semiconductor testing industry.
